What documents are required for property registration?

For property registration, you'll need identity proof (Aadhar/PAN), recent photographs, sale deed, previous ownership documents, and NOC from relevant authorities. Our legal property documentation services team ensures you have all required paperwork properly prepared.

How long does the documentation process take?

The typical documentation process through our legal documentation services takes 15-30 days, depending on property type and local regulations. This includes verification, preparation, and registration steps. We work efficiently to minimize delays.

What is included in the property documents list?

The essential property documents list includes the sale deed, property tax receipts, encumbrance certificate, approved building plan, occupancy certificate, and society maintenance bills. Our experts ensure all documentation meets legal requirements.

How do I verify property ownership?

Property ownership can be verified through title deed examination, encumbrance certificate review, and property tax records check. Our legal property documentation services team conducts thorough verification using government records and legal databases.

What Are Notary Services for Property Documents?

The Notary services render legal validation of property records by a state-appointed agent referred to as a Notary Public. This professional is an unbiased witness who confirms the identities of the signatories and confirms the signature of documents to be done freely and consciously.

A Notary Public in India is a government appointed qualified lawyer, who is usually intended to validate the identity of individuals, comprehension of the documents, voluntary participation and the authentication of the documents by their official seal and signature.

These services introduce an extra level of security to the real estate transactions because they help to avoid fraud and evidence that the correct procedures were observed.

Property Documents That Require Notarization

Although the notarization of property documents is not required by law in India, there are a number of key real estate documents that the added notarization can be helpful.

Power of Attorney forms give the power to someone else to manage your property business on your behalf, whereas affidavits are affidavits sworn statements that are used to declare ownership, change of names and heir information

Notarization adds more legitimacy to property-related agreements such as the leases and partition arrangements, and gift deeds and mortgages papers pre-emptively enjoy the benefit of identity verification and fraud prevention that come with notarization.

Notarization vs. Registration

One of the most common confusions in property transactions is the difference between notarization and registration. These are distinct legal processes serving different purposes. Notarization verifies identities and willing participation, acts as a fraud deterrent, and is typically simpler and less expensive (₹50-500 per document). Registration, on the other hand, creates a permanent public record, legally transfers property rights, is mandatory for sale deeds, involves higher fees based on property value, and typically takes longer to complete. As our legal expert explains, "A notary confirms who signed a document, while registration officially records what was signed."

Benefits of Notarizing Property Documents

While some property documents legally require registration rather than notarization, there are several significant advantages to notarizing property documents.

1

Fraud Prevention

Notarization verifies the identity of signatories, significantly reducing the risk of forgery or impersonation in property transactions.

2

Enhanced Legal Standing

Notarized documents carry greater weight in legal proceedings than unnotarized ones, potentially offering an advantage in property disputes.

3

Easier Document Processing

Many institutions, including banks and government offices, process notarized documents more readily, streamlining subsequent transactions.

4

Protection for All Parties

Notarization ensures all participants understand and willingly consent to the agreement terms, protecting both buyers and sellers.

5

Practical Advantages

These benefits translate to smoother loan approvals, easier property transfers, stronger legal evidence, and significant peace of mind during major financial transactions.

FAQs
1. Is notarization mandatory for all property documents in India? +

No, not all property documents require notarization. However, certain documents like Power of Attorney and affidavits benefit significantly from notarization. Property sale deeds generally require registration rather than notarization.

2. Can a notarized property document replace registration? +

No, notarization and registration serve different legal purposes. For documents like sale deeds that legally transfer property ownership, registration is mandatory under the Registration Act, regardless of notarization.

3. How long does the notarization process take? +

Basic notarization typically takes 15-30 minutes once you meet with the notary. However, you should allocate additional time for document preparation and potential waiting at the notary's office.

4. Do all parties need to be physically present for notarization? +

Yes, all signatories must generally appear in person before the notary. This requirement helps prevent fraud by allowing the notary to verify identities and confirm willing participation.

5.How can NRIs get property documents notarized for Indian properties? +

NRIs can either visit India to complete notarization or use a special Power of Attorney. Documents executed abroad typically require notarization in the foreign country followed by attestation by the Indian Embassy or Consulate for use in India.

Five Easy Legal Hints to Buyers

These real estate legal tips should be applied so that the purchase is smooth. Each step builds on the last. Pros advise them to reduce risks.

1

Check the Title of the Property

Check title deed to ownership- go back 30 years on any claims. Obtain an encumbrance certificate, to ascertain the absence of loans or liens. To prevent fraud, legal due diligence to the buyers begins here.

Always have an attorney do it, it is hard to see through red flags. Such online tools as state portals are beneficial. This is done to establish the right to sell by the seller. If issues pop up, walk away. Upon clean titles there is peace of mind. Most deals fall flat in the absence of this check.

2

Secure RERA Compliance of New Projects

In the case of properties, which are under-construction, ensure RERA registration-it is a requirement of the builders. This legislation cushions against time wastage and funds are allocated to the project. Details such as timelines and amenities have to be similar to promises.

Most complaints or approvals are listed on the RERA site. Avoid fines by skipping non compliant projects. It is one of the most important tips of real estate legal buying. The builders are required to offer corrective measures to defects over a period of five years. This builds trust. Before investing, cross-check always.

3

Get ready for a good Sale Agreement

Prepare a clear agreement touching on price, terms of payment and date of possession. Provide delay or cancellation clauses. The written terms are used in Property buying in India to avoid disputes.

Have it examined by an attorney- oral agreements do not work. Legally stamp it. This protects both sides. Incur escrows when necessary. It holds money in safe deposit until the circumstances arise. Small measures such as this prevent huge problems.

4

Handle Registration and Stamp Duty Right

Record sale deed in the office of sub- registry within four months. Pay stamp tax according to rates of your state--it can be 5-7 percent of the property value. This is a tip that the legal requirements of real estate recommends one should budget.

Carry along all documents such as IDs and witnesses. Delays may cause unnecessary additional expenses. By adequate registration, you become the legitimate proprietor. The mistake of underpayment of duty is usual, and it is better to rely on the calculators. It ensures smooth transfer. Follow rules for a valid deal.

5

Watch for Common Fraud Signs

Watch out on hasty transactions, cash only offers or ambiguous property description. Check building permit and the land title. Legal due diligence to buyers identifies scams in time. Use known agents and unchecked middlemen are not to be used. Indicators of suspicion of the report to the authorities. This keeps your money safe.

Documents Needed While Leasing Your Property +

Documents Needed While Leasing Your Property


Passive income can be achieved by renting your property to better use your investment. However, it does not just end with handshakes but must be documented in order to have clear terms and ensure that both parties are not involved in a dispute. Whether it is identity checks or legal documents, the correct documentwork will ensure a lawful, hassle-free lease. You may be an experienced landlord or a first-time one, but read on to discover the documentation you will require.

1

Property Ownership Proof

Giving evidence of ownership is obligatory to demonstrate that you are legally entitled to lease the property. A sale deed, title deed or recent property tax receipts are acceptable documents. This evidence provides a sense of credibility, instills confidence in the tenants and also secures you legally by eliminating any future confusion.

2

Identity Proof

Checking identities is advantageous to the landlords as well as tenants. A typical ID document is a PAN card, passport, or Aadhaar card. Having such records on file allows transparency and ensures that you can verify who a tenant is in case of any disputes in the course of the lease.

3

Lease Agreement

The lease agreement is the basis of the relationship between the landlord and the tenant. It defines such important terms as rent, term of the lease and sum of deposit needed and the maintenance needed. The contract should be stamped and registered legally and it should have explicit clauses of eviction or termination. A well‑drafted lease protects you from potential legal complications.

4

Police Verification Report

In many cases, the law will demand a police verification report to prove that the tenant is legitimate. It will avoid any form of illegality at the property. Receiving this report safeguards the interests of the landlord and offers him or her a sense of security since only reliable tenants are placed into the property.

5

No Objection Certificate (NOC)

In case the property is under loan or mortgage, landlords typically require a No Objection Certificate (NOC) by the lender. The NOC certifies that you are allowed by law to rent the property. Obtaining the NOC will ensure a lack of conflicts with the loan agreement. It prevents issues of legal problems during the lease period.

6

Utility Bill Receipts

Giving the latest utility bills of electricity, water or gas will be a confirmation that the dues are paid. The transfer is clear as a result of these receipts. They demonstrate that new tenants will not be receiving old unpaid bills so that there will be a smooth transition.

FAQs About Leasing Documents
Why is a property ownership proof required for leasing? +

Ownership proof ensures the landlord has the legal right to rent the property, protecting both the landlord and tenant.

How can I ensure a rental agreement is valid? +

It must be "stamped and registered" as per legal requirements to hold enforceable weight in court if needed.

Is police verification mandatory for tenants? +

Yes, it is legally required in many cities to ensure safety and protect landlords from potential liability issues.

What happens if I lease without a No Objection Certificate? +

Leasing without a NOC when required may breach loan agreements or legal rules, leading to complications.

Why are utility bills important when leasing? +

They prove no outstanding debts are associated with utilities, ensuring tenants start afresh without hidden liabilities.
